你查询的IP:[60.224.252.115]  地理位置:澳大利亚Telstra网络

最新查询119.107.195.241 210.26.33.4 221.190.180.144 221.2.98.90 60.1.159.12 60.29.251.227 218.45.215.34 122.51.219.223 120.187.93.102 221.141.87.88 119.0.90.0 60.224.252.115 118.72.7.159 117.128.125.64 119.60.214.160 118.239.202.200 203.152.64.71 222.248.86.38 58.68.128.148 202.60.112.111 203.156.192.122 220.242.135.141 117.76.103.201 119.232.129.255 120.128.33.52 203.207.128.97 124.64.173.1 202.180.128.120 203.100.80.143 202.180.128.202 211.96.230.204 123.242.138.59 119.59.128.4